Relevance. Currently, downy mildew of cucumber (peronosporosis) is the most harmful disease on this crop in the open ground, has an epiphytotic character and causes significant damage to the crop of greens. Material and methods. The research was carried out on selection and collection material of the laboratory of selection and seed production of pumpkin crops in the open and protected ground of the Moscow region. At least 300 collection and selection samples of cucumber were sown in the open and protected ground (Moscow region) every year, for phytopathological evaluation. Their defeat by downy mildew was taken into account on a 5-point scale. Results. Among the varieties of FSBSI FSVC selection, were less affected by this disease: Edinstvo, Electron 2, Vodoley, Vodopad, F1 Debut, F1 Krepish, F1 Brunette, F1 Frant, F1 Krasotka and F1 VNIISSOK 1. The most resistant to peronosporosis were Japanese varieties – Sadao rishu, Jibai, Higan Fushinari, Tropical slicer and others. Some Polish hybrids – Aladyn (SKW 190), Heron (SKW 290) and Parys (SKW 390), also had increased resistance to downy mildew. It should be noted that the varieties Jerelo and Geim from Ukraine; Dutch hybrids – F1 Sequenza, F1 Bejo 1612, F1 Pontia, 85/2292, F1 Donia mix; from the United States – F1 Calypso. In the selection for resistance to downy mildew you can to use varieties created in the Far East, the Crimean experimental breeding station. As a result of the annual assessment of parent forms on a natural infectious background, samples with increased resistance to downy mildew were selected.

Development institutions are an important modern instrument of government regulation of the economy in all developed countries. The system of development institutions of the Russian Federation includes the federal and regional development institutions. Key federal development institutions include such well-known state corporations as the investment fund of the Russian Federation; the State Corporation "Bank for Development and Foreign Economic Activity (Vnesheconombank)"; the state corporation "Russian Corporation of Nanotechnologies," etc. According to experts of the Ministry of Economic Development of the Russian Federation, about 200 regional development institutions operate on the territory of the constituent entities of the Russian Federation. The objectives of this extensive system of development institutions so far have been to overcome the so-called "market failures," which cannot be optimally realized by the market mechanisms, and to promote the sustained economic growth of a country or an individual region. In November 2020, the Government of the Russian Federation announced the reform of the system of development institutions in the country. The article analyzes the goals and main directions of the announced reform. On the example of the system of development institutions of the Far East, an attempt was made to assess its possible consequences.

On the basis of quantitative and qualitative expert sociological surveys, the article presents a model of anti-corruption education in Russia. This model is formed by seven main elements: basis, principles, subjects, objects, methods and means, content of materials (semantic orientation), indicators of the effectiveness of anti-corruption education. Comparing the obtained sociological data characterizing these elements with the corresponding elements of the anti-corruption mechanism enshrined in the current regulatory legal acts of the Russian Federation, the authors identified a number of inconsistencies. They concern, first of all, the principles, subjects of implementation of anti-corruption education, as well as indicators for assessing its effectiveness. For example, experts suggest using non-statutory principles of financial support and standardization of materials presented in the framework of such education when conducting anti-corruption education. At the same time, for the optimization of management decisions in the field of anti-corruption education, scientific and practical interest and contradictions identified within the obtained sociological data are of interest. Such contradictions are most clearly traced in relation to the subjects and objects of anti-corruption education.

The article describes the results of the implementation of the PTHA (Probabilistic Tsunami Hazard Assessment) methodology for creating the overview maps of tsunami hazard for the Far East coast of the Russian Federation. Such maps show the characteristics of the catastrophic impact of tsunami waves on the coast and the probability of their exceeding in a given period of time. The methodological basis of the PTHA approach to the assessment of tsunami hazard, the problems of constructing seismotectonic models of the main tsunamigenic zones, mathematical models and algorithms for calculating probability estimates of tsunami danger are discussed. The version of the PTHA methodology outlined in the article is implemented as a “WTmap” Web-application that has an access to the entire observational information related to coastal tsunami zoning and software packages used. The application allows to obtain the estimates of the expected tsunami heights and their recurrence estimates and to map them on specific parts of the Far Eastern coast of the Russian Federation. The obtained estimates can be quickly recalculated when replacing the observational catalogs with more complete and reliable ones, with the addition of new, previously absent events or the revision of their parameters, as well as the results of new scenario calculations. Examples of overview maps for various recurrence intervals, constructed using the PTHA methodology and presented using the “WTMap” application, are given. Some problems of using the PTHA methodology related to the lack of available observational data and to the complexity of performing a large amount of scenario simulations are also discussed.

The article is devoted to the analysis of the problems of protecting the right of indigenous peoples of the Far East to traditional fishing. To improve the legal regulation in this area, according to the author of the article, will allow the development of special procedures for resolving disputes with the participation of indigenous minorities, as well as amending the legislation of the Russian Federation regulating the rules of traditional fishing for indigenous minorities.
